A Conservative peer highlighted the alarming global industry centered on child abuse, noting that live-streamed images of such exploits fuel a multi-billion-pound business. The urgency of addressing this issue was underscored, as he expressed confidence that the House of Lords would back proposed amendments aimed at combating this heinous activity. Nash emphasized the amendment’s goal of safeguarding children from abuse, reflecting a critical need for legislative action to prevent these crimes. By raising awareness about this massive, illegal industry, he aims to garner support for measures that protect vulnerable youth and enhance child safety online. This discussion underscores the intersection of technology and child protection, emphasizing the importance of proactive legislation in the digital age.
